The Tws Foundation

The Tws Foundation's latest filing in the PeerBasis snapshot reports a Part VII D + F figure of $30,000 for Edward Wavak, Trustee (FY 2025). Column F can include amounts from the filing and related organizations.

After indexing supported filing years to 2025 comparison dollars, the subject figure is $30,000. It is higher than the D + F figure for 15 of 44 peer organizations selected under the disclosed tier Same NTEE sector (A11), nationwide + size band 0.67–1.5× revenue (approximately 34%; median $58,307). This is descriptive, not a reasonableness conclusion.

Actual selection tier: Same NTEE sector (A11), nationwide + size band 0.67–1.5× revenue. Displayed D + F figures from supported filing years are indexed to 2025 comparison dollars with BLS CPI-U; a nationwide tier also uses 2024 BEA RPP as a consumer price-level proxy when both the subject and peer have supported state codes. Unsupported state codes receive no interstate adjustment. Comparison values can differ from the raw filing. Column F may include related-organization amounts.
